    • GRO ref: TANTON, Elizabeth q1 1845 Holborn RD 2 99

      I think the above is the most likely, but by no means certain. Elizabeth's death was probably either in 1845 or 1849, as she was with her husband in 1841 but not in 1851:
      The other possibility:    
      Tanton, Elizabeth q1 1849 Hollingbourne RD 5 238

      Hollingbourne RD was where Elizabeth came from - had she returned to relations to be cared for? But Joseph was from Lenham as well, and I suspect the Elizabeth who died in 1849 was a relation of Joseph's - but not his wife.
      Holborn RD includes Grays Inn Parish. At the time of the 1841 census the family were living in the Grays Inn district of St. Pancras parish, so I think they were close to Holborn RD if not in it; this death could easily be this Elizabeth's.
